Red Mage (Final Fantasy Tactics Advance)

Viera Red Mage

Red Mage is a job class from Final Fantasy Tactics Advance and is only available to Vieras after mastering one Fencer skill. Red Mages are a small blend of Black and White Mages, and also have a few status ailment spells. They have well rounded stat growth between physical and magic attack power. Because of this, don't count them out when they're silenced, because they still can jab that rapier with suprising attack power. Red Mages are also blessed with the amazing skill Doublecast.

[edit] Doublecast Info

Doublecast works by casting two magic spells at once. However, this is not limited to Red Magic. If, for example, Spirit Magic is the secondary A-Ability, you can use those spells when Doublecasting. A special quirk about Doublecast is that you can use it to bypass some laws like Fire, Lightning, Ice, and Holy because Doublecast is only seen as a Red Magic skill with no elemental affiliation. Doublecasted magic is always considered Red Magic aswell, so if a law disallows Summoning, the Red Mage can doublecast them without being penalized.
The MP cost of Doublecast is the combined totals of the magic casted, and so may vary from use to use.
